About Karhara Village

Karhara is one of the larger villages in Madhepur tehsil, in the district of Madhubani, Bihar. The Census of India 2011 recorded a population of 5,275, made up of 2,706 males and 2,569 females. That works out to a sex ratio of about 949 females per 1000 males. The village covers 730 hectares hectares. Its pincode is 847408, shared with the other villages in the same post office area.
